Choose the right product tier

Tier Best fit Notes
Serverless Fast experiments and production traffic on models already hosted by Parasail Use the models endpoint to check availability before wiring a model into an application.
Dedicated Instances Private models, custom Hugging Face models, predictable capacity, or model settings that need full endpoint control Start in the UI when possible so the compatibility checker can validate model and hardware choices.
Batch Large offline jobs, evaluation sets, embeddings, and workloads that do not need immediate responses Use custom_id values so outputs can be matched back to inputs and failed requests can be retried selectively.

Check live availability

Use the models endpoint before committing to a model name:

curl https://api.parasail.io/v1/models \
  -H "Authorization: Bearer $PARASAIL_API_KEY"

The response lists the serverless models available to your account. For Dedicated Instances, use the deployment flow or the Dedicated compatibility checks to validate public or private Hugging Face model IDs.

Run a repeatable evaluation

Use one evaluation set for every candidate model.

  1. Collect representative prompts, documents, images, tool schemas, or expected JSON schemas from your product.
  2. Run the same inputs through each candidate model.
  3. Save the raw request, raw response, latency, token usage, and pass/fail result for each input.
  4. Review failures by category: wrong answer, bad format, missing tool call, hallucination, timeout, or cost outlier.
  5. Promote only models that meet your quality, latency, cost, and feature-support thresholds.

For small evaluations, call Serverless or Dedicated endpoints directly. For large offline evaluations, use Batch so you can process many requests at lower cost and retry failed rows by custom_id.

For private or fine-tuned models, start with Dedicated Instances and validate the model ID in the deployment flow before running a full evaluation.
